The three units Intuit programs to sell - Quicken, QuickBase and Demandforce - paid for for less than 6% of the solid's financial 2015 revenue, and just 2% of its online income during the exact same period. For the final 12 a few months, Quicken offered simply $51 million to the business's overall revenue of nearly $4.2 billion.
One indication of the sóon-to-be-soId products' worth in traders' eye is certainly that not one Walls Street expert inquired a issue yesterday about their proposed purchase. If Intuit keeps to its normal timetable, it will ship Quicken 2016 in the next several days. Quicken 2015, for example, released in earlier August 2014, while Quicken 2014 made an appearance in earlier October 2013. Quicken is one of the oldest desktop computer products, previous even Home windows. Quicken débuted in 1983, near the starting of the Personal computer trend, and very first ran on Microsoft's i9000 DOS.
